
Aligning and setting the monitoring pressure on a turntable is a vital step in making certain optimum sound high quality and stopping harm to your data. Monitoring pressure is the downward stress exerted by the stylus on the document, and it have to be set accurately to make sure that the stylus is making correct contact with the document’s grooves.
The significance of appropriate monitoring pressure can’t be overstated. If the monitoring pressure is simply too gentle, the stylus is not going to make correct contact with the document’s grooves, leading to poor sound high quality and potential harm to the document. Conversely, if the monitoring pressure is simply too heavy, the stylus will dig into the document’s grooves, inflicting extreme put on and distortion.
To align and set the monitoring pressure in your turntable, you’ll need just a few instruments, together with a stylus pressure gauge, an alignment protractor, and a small screwdriver. The stylus pressure gauge is used to measure the downward stress exerted by the stylus, whereas the alignment protractor is used to make sure that the stylus is aligned accurately with the document’s grooves. The screwdriver is used to regulate the monitoring pressure.
After you have gathered your instruments, you’ll be able to start the method of aligning and setting the monitoring pressure. First, place the alignment protractor on the turntable and align it with the spindle. Then, place the document on the turntable and decrease the stylus onto the protractor. The stylus must be aligned with the traces on the protractor.
As soon as the stylus is aligned, you’ll be able to set the monitoring pressure. To do that, use the stylus pressure gauge to measure the downward stress exerted by the stylus. The monitoring pressure must be set to the producer’s specs, which may sometimes be discovered within the turntable’s handbook.
As soon as the monitoring pressure is about, you’ll be able to start taking part in data. Be sure you test the monitoring pressure periodically to make sure that it’s nonetheless set accurately.

Ideas for Aligning and Setting Monitoring Power on a Turntable
To make sure optimum sound high quality and forestall harm to data, it’s essential to accurately align and set the monitoring pressure on a turntable. Listed below are some tricks to information you thru the method:
Tip 1: Use a Stylus Power Gauge
A stylus pressure gauge is a vital device for precisely measuring the downward stress exerted by the stylus on the document. This measurement, often known as monitoring pressure, must be set in accordance with the producer’s specs for the cartridge and stylus mixture getting used.
Tip 2: Align the Cartridge
Correct cartridge alignment ensures that the stylus is positioned accurately in relation to the document’s grooves. Use an alignment protractor to align the cartridge in order that the stylus is perpendicular to the document’s floor and centered between the spindle gap and the outer fringe of the document.
Tip 3: Regulate the Counterweight
The counterweight on the tonearm is used to regulate the monitoring pressure. Flip the counterweight clockwise to extend the monitoring pressure or counterclockwise to lower it. Consult with the stylus pressure gauge to confirm that the specified monitoring pressure is achieved.
Tip 4: Test the Anti-Skating Power
Anti-skating pressure counteracts the inward pull of the stylus in direction of the middle of the document, making certain that the stylus tracks the grooves evenly. Regulate the anti-skating pressure in accordance with the producer’s suggestions.
Tip 5: Hearken to Your Data
After aligning and setting the monitoring pressure, take heed to your data to evaluate the sound high quality. In the event you discover any distortion or skipping, it could point out an incorrect alignment or monitoring pressure. Positive-tune the settings as crucial.
Tip 6: Commonly Test and Regulate
Over time, the alignment and monitoring pressure of a turntable could change as a result of elements comparable to temperature fluctuations or unintended bumps. Periodically test and alter these settings to keep up optimum efficiency.
Tip 7: Deal with with Care
When dealing with the turntable, tonearm, and cartridge, all the time train warning to keep away from damaging the fragile parts. Use a tender brush to scrub the stylus and deal with the data by their edges to stop fingerprints or scratches.
